Company Description SumeetSSG is an Indo-Spanish joint venture between Sumeet Group Enterprises (India) and SSG Transporte Sanitario (Spain), focused on advancing emergency medical services in India. The organization is committed to delivering fast, efficient, and world-class emergency response by applying proven European best practices, technology, and protocols at scale. With a strong emphasis on “SEVA,” SumeetSSG aims to serve and contribute to the wellbeing of over 120 million people in Maharashtra. The company is driven by the vision of transforming emergency medical care across the country, offering meaningful roles to professionals who want to make a direct impact on patient outcomes.Role Description The Emergency Medical Service Officer role is a full-time, on-site position based in the Pune,Thane,Palghar, Raigad,Kolhapur, Mumbai Suburban,Marathwada zone,Nandurbar,Dhule.The Officer is responsible for providing high-quality pre-hospital emergency medical care, assessing patient conditions, stabilizing patients, and coordinating timely transport to appropriate medical facilities. Day-to-day tasks include working closely with physicians and other healthcare professionals, following established clinical protocols, maintaining medical equipment and supplies, and ensuring accurate documentation of all interventions and patient information. The role also involves participating in ongoing training, drills, and quality improvement initiatives, as well as educating patients and families on immediate care needs and safety practices in emergency situations.Qualifications BAMS/BUMSCandidates should possess strong foundational skills in Medicine, including knowledge of emergency care protocols and clinical decision-making.Candidates should demonstrate excellent Patient Care skills, with the ability to assess, stabilize, and support patients in high-stress situations.Candidates should have readiness in Training, both in receiving advanced emergency medical instruction and in supporting team education and drills.Strong communication skills, ability to remain calm under pressure, and commitment to patient safety and ethical practice.Willingness to work in shifts, including nights, weekends, and holidays, as required in emergency response operations.Familiarity with local languages (such as Marathi and Hindi) is an advantage for effective patient interaction .
